<?xml version="1.0"?>
<doc>
<assembly>
<name>LumiSoft.Net</name>
</assembly>
<members>
<member name="T:LumiSoft.Net.SIP.Message.SIP_t_ContactParam">
<summary>
Implements SIP "contact-param" value. Defined in RFC 3261.
</summary>
<remarks>
<code>
RFC 3261 Syntax:
contact-param = (name-addr / addr-spec) *(SEMI contact-params)
contact-params = c-p-q / c-p-expires / contact-extension
c-p-q = "q" EQUAL qvalue
c-p-expires = "expires" EQUAL delta-seconds
contact-extension = generic-param
delta-seconds = 1*DIGIT
</code>
</remarks>
</member>
<member name="T:LumiSoft.Net.SIP.Message.SIP_t_ValueWithParams">
<summary>
This base class for SIP data types what has parameters support.
</summary>
</member>
<member name="T:LumiSoft.Net.SIP.Message.SIP_t_Value">
<summary>
This base class for all SIP data types.
</summary>
</member>
<member name="M:LumiSoft.Net.SIP.Message.SIP_t_Value.#ctor">
<summary>
Default constructor.
</summary>
</member>
<member name="M:LumiSoft.Net.SIP.Message.SIP_t_Value.Parse(LumiSoft.Net.StringReader)">
<summary>
Parses single value from specified reader.
</summary>
<param name="reader">Reader what contains </param>
</member>
<member name="M:LumiSoft.Net.SIP.Message.SIP_t_Value.ToStringValue">
<summary>
Convert this to string value.
</summary>
<returns>Returns this as string value.</returns>
</member>
<member name="M:LumiSoft.Net.SIP.Message.SIP_t_ValueWithParams.#ctor">
<summary>
Default constructor.
</summary>
</member>
<member name="M:LumiSoft.Net.SIP.Message.SIP_t_ValueWithParams.ParseParameters(LumiSoft.Net.StringReader)">
<summary>
Parses parameters from specified reader. Reader position must be where parameters begin.
</summary>
<param name="reader">Reader from where to read parameters.</param>
<exception cref="T:LumiSoft.Net.SIP.Message.SIP_ParseException">Raised when invalid SIP message.</exception>
</member>
<member name="M:LumiSoft.Net.SIP.Message.SIP_t_ValueWithParams.ParametersToString">
<summary>
Convert parameters to valid parameters string.
</summary>
<returns>Returns parameters string.</returns>
</member>
<member name="P:LumiSoft.Net.SIP.Message.SIP_t_ValueWithParams.Parameters">
<summary>
Gets via parameters.
</summary>
</member>
<member name="M:LumiSoft.Net.SIP.Message.SIP_t_ContactParam.#ctor">
<summary>
Default constructor.
</summary>
</member>
<member name="M:LumiSoft.Net.SIP.Message.SIP_t_ContactParam.Parse(System.String)">
<summary>
Parses "contact-param" from specified value.
</summary>
<param name="value">SIP "contact-param" value.</param>
<exception cref="T:System.ArgumentNullException">Raised when <b>value</b> is null.</exception>
<exception cref="T:LumiSoft.Net.SIP.Message.SIP_ParseException">Raised when invalid SIP message.</exception>
</member>
<member name="M:LumiSoft.Net.SIP.Message.SIP_t_ContactParam.Parse(LumiSoft.Net.StringReader)">
<summary>
Parses "contact-param" from specified reader.
</summary>
<param name="reader">Reader from where to parse.</param>
<exception cref="T:System.ArgumentNullException">Raised when <b>reader</b> is null.</exception>
<exception cref="T:LumiSoft.Net.SIP.Message.SIP_ParseException">Raised when invalid SIP message.</exception>
</member>
<member name="M:LumiSoft.Net.SIP.Message.SIP_t_ContactParam.ToStringValue">
<summary>
Converts this to valid "contact-param" value.
</summary>
<returns>Returns "contact-param" value.</returns>
</member>
<member name="P:LumiSoft.Net.SIP.Message.SIP_t_ContactParam.IsStarContact">
<summary>
Gets is this SIP contact is special STAR contact.
</summary>
</member>
<member name="P:LumiSoft.Net.SIP.Message.SIP_t_ContactParam.Address">
<summary>
Gets contact address.
</summary>
</member>
<member name="P:LumiSoft.Net.SIP.Message.SIP_t_ContactParam.QValue">
<summary>
Gets or sets qvalue parameter. Targets are processed from highest qvalue to lowest.
This value must be between 0.0 and 1.0. Value -1 means that value not specified.
</summary>
</member>
<member name="P:LumiSoft.Net.SIP.Message.SIP_t_ContactParam.Expires">
<summary>
Gets or sets expire parameter (time in seconds when contact expires). Value -1 means not specified.
</summary>
</member>
<member name="T:LumiSoft.Net.SIP.Message.SIP_t_NameAddress">
<summary>
Implements SIP "name-addr" value. Defined in RFC 3261.
</summary>
<remarks>
<code>
RFC 3261 Syntax:
name-addr = [ display-name ] LAQUOT addr-spec RAQUOT
addr-spec = SIP-URI / SIPS-URI / absoluteURI
</code>
</remarks>
</member>
<member name="M:LumiSoft.Net.SIP.Message.SIP_t_NameAddress.#ctor">
<summary>
Default constructor.
</summary>
</member>
<member name="M:LumiSoft.Net.SIP.Message.SIP_t_NameAddress.#ctor(System.String)">
<summary>
Default constructor.
</summary>
<param name="value">SIP <b>name-addr</b> value.</param>
<exception cref="T:System.ArgumentNullException">Raised when <b>reader</b> is null.</exception>
<exception cref="T:LumiSoft.Net.SIP.Message.SIP_ParseException">Raised when invalid SIP message.</exception>
</member>
<member name="M:LumiSoft.Net.SIP.Message.SIP_t_NameAddress.#ctor(System.String,LumiSoft.Net.AbsoluteUri)">
<summary>
Default constructor.
</summary>
<param name="displayName">Display name.</param>
<param name="uri">Uri.</param>
<exception cref="T:System.ArgumentNullException">Is raised when <b>uri</b> is null reference.</exception>
</member>
<member name="M:LumiSoft.Net.SIP.Message.SIP_t_NameAddress.Parse(System.String)">
<summary>
Parses "name-addr" or "addr-spec" from specified value.
</summary>
<param name="value">SIP "name-addr" or "addr-spec" value.</param>
<exception cref="T:System.ArgumentNullException">Raised when <b>reader</b> is null.</exception>
<exception cref="T:LumiSoft.Net.SIP.Message.SIP_ParseException">Raised when invalid SIP message.</exception>
</member>
<member name="M:LumiSoft.Net.SIP.Message.SIP_t_NameAddress.Parse(LumiSoft.Net.StringReader)">
<summary>
Parses "name-addr" or "addr-spec" from specified reader.
</summary>
<param name="reader">Reader from where to parse.</param>
<exception cref="T:System.ArgumentNullException">Raised when <b>reader